About Cummings Km
Cummings Km is a scholar working on Oncology, Physiology, General Health Professions, Surgery and Pathology and Forensic Medicine, having authored 24 papers that have together received 375 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Global Cancer Incidence and Screening (6 papers), Smoking Behavior and Cessation (4 papers), Pharmaceutical Practices and Patient Outcomes (1 paper), Breast Cancer Treatment Studies (1 paper), Genetic factors in colorectal cancer (1 paper), Testicular diseases and treatments (1 paper), Pediatric Pain Management Techniques (1 paper) and Colorectal Cancer Screening and Detection (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Family Practice (20 citations), Physiology (141 citations), Applied Psychology (26 citations), Speech and Hearing (34 citations) and Oncology (95 citations). Cummings Km has collaborated with scholars based in United States. Frequent co-authors include Russell Sciandra, C Mettlin, Terry F. Pechacek, Jeffrey L. Fellows, Jun Yang, Paul Mowery, Joseph E. Bauer, Andrew Hyland, Catherine Vena and Linda L. Pederson. Their work appears in journals such as American Journal of Public Health, PubMed and LSHTM Research Online (London School of Hygiene and Tropical Medicine).
